By the way, it's the same approach that I have to big tech engaging in censorship. And I think we ought to change. Right now there's a provision called section 230 of the Communications Decency act that immunizes big tech from lawsuits almost across the board. I have long advocated creating an Exception to section 230 that if you engage in political censorship, you should face lawsuits. (16:30–16:39)
